Transaction 3bbff697b05b0902bfd73b6631f438a8baa454188655461f93693b43e542c20f

1 Input
2 Outputs
  • 3bbff697b05b0902bfd73b6631f438a8baa454188655461f93693b43e542c20f:0
  • value  7000000
    address  17T6WtQ84cpGdFYLJtoYuyZUKRgoDWjXsr
  • 3bbff697b05b0902bfd73b6631f438a8baa454188655461f93693b43e542c20f:1
  • value  6842956637
    address  3HQcSTsB552ngHwpLuSgp7XJ8gUE3RvGRY